    • @GarageKei
      @GarageKei  Před rokem +6

      I knew someone would bring that up....
      I'm not sure.
      Speculation was made but we weren't given a full pre and post race brief from the skyline race team on what their official excuse for getting thrashed was but I'm sure it would have been something like that.😂😂😂
      If you agree to race and your car isn't up to scratch then that's on you and there is no excuses to be made. "Oh but the car was misfiring". Then why did you race?
      I used to care about stuff like that deeply. Then I saw the recent Kei car drag race video that was a total and utter balls up and gave up on it. The fact is it lost. the reason why is totally irrelevant.
      In this case it's 660cc f6a vs a 2600cc RB26 that's over 3 times the displacement.
      Cappuccino has a curb weight of 725kg. 2 of the 3 cars that run are full interior and everything. bigger intercoolers etc so could be even heavier...
      Skyline is double that at 1430kg looked to be full interior.
      We didn't get a claimed HP rating for the 3 Cappuccino that beat the skyline but I'd guess 130-150 HP max.
      The skyline came in boasting 400hp...
      Double the weight. Without question more than double the HP....
      4wd and got chopped off the line.....
      He lost by a LOT... Wasn't even close.
